WebJan 24, 2024 · In-Text Citation: Identify the primary source and then write "as cited in" the secondary source. According to Zimmerman, (2002, as cited in Grossman, 2009) “metacognition is defined as the awareness of and knowledge about one’s own thinking” (p.17). “Metacognition is defined as the awareness of and knowledge about one’s own … WebThis Library video will demonstrate to reference a book using the APA 7th edition style.Access the Western Sydney Library Referencing and Citation Guides:htt...
